Silver sugar spoon with agate handle – Gerrit van der Dussen, Schoonhoven

An elegant silver sugar spoon with a beautiful agate handle , crafted by Schoonhoven silversmith Gerrit van der Dussen . This silversmith worked from 1867 to 1912 and is known for his meticulous and high-quality silverwork.

The spoon is hallmarked with the sword for second-grade silver (835/1000) and the maker's mark GD109 , which can be attributed to Gerrit van der Dussen of Schoonhoven . The combination of silver with a natural agate handle is characteristic of luxury silverware from the late 19th and early 20th centuries.

At approximately 14cm in length and weighing 16g , this is a finely crafted and easy-to-handle piece, suitable for both use and collection.
